js(6)
-
Node.js
Node.js의 주요 특징을 아래와 같이 나열할 수 있습니다: 이벤트 기반: Node.js는 비동기 및 이벤트 기반의 프로그래밍 모델을 채택하여 I/O 작업을 효율적으로 처리할 수 있습니다. 이를 통해 여러 작업을 동시에 처리하고 높은 성능을 제공할 수 있습니다. 논 블로킹: Node.js는 단일 쓰레드로 동작하며 비동기 I/O를 지원합니다. 이는 많은 클라이언트 요청에 대해 블로킹되지 않고 빠르게 응답할 수 있도록 합니다. 싱글스레드: JavaScript 런타임 클릭,요청,타이머 등 이벤트리스너:이벤트 등록 함수 콜백함수: 발생 조건 시 예약함수 실행 논블로킹: 긴 시간 함수를 백그라운드로 보내고 다음 코드를 실행, 오래 걸리는 함수를 나중에 실행 일부코드:I/O(파일,네트워크),압축,암호화 나머지코드..
2024.04.15 -
import/export
import/export 사용법 1.export deafult 변수명 export defatult 변수명; ##파일 내 한 변수 혹은 데이터 그대로 export {변수명1,변수명2}; ##여러 변수들의 export 2.import 변수명 from 상기 import 파일 경로 import 변수1 from ''; default 변수를 불러올 때 import {변수1} from ''; export {}변수들 중에서 불러올 때
2024.03.16 -
react 1.엘리먼트
Element 어떤 물체를 구성하는 성분 Elements are the smallest building blocks of React apps. 엘리먼트 리액트앱을 구성하는 가장 작은 빌딩 블록 돔 엘리먼트(웹페이지 Elements에서 확인) vs 리액트 엘리먼트 차이 화면에 나타나는 내용을 기술하는 자바스크립트 객체 Descriptor로 시작 >> 디스크립퍼가 최종적으로 나타나는 형태는 DOM 엘리먼트, 돔과의 통일성을 위해 엘리먼트라 부름 브라우저 돔에 존재하면 돔 엘리먼트(리액트 엘리먼트에 비해 더 많은 정보를 담고 있어 크고 무거움) 리액트 버추얼 돔에 존재하면 리액트 엘리먼트 결국 리액트 엘리먼트는 돔 엘리먼트의 가상표현(랜더링시 돔 엘리먼트가 되는) 자바스크립트 객체형태(=컴포넌트의 유형과 속성..
2022.07.24 -
react
html : 하이퍼 텍스트 마크업 랭기지 (데이터를 처리하는 추가정보를 의미하는 마크업, 이를 다루는 언어는 마크업언어) 요소:시작태그~끝태그(혹은 끝태그 없음) 태그: hi 양 끝 속성: 태그안에 들어가는 정보 :html표시의 시작과 끝 :웹사이트에 대한 설명,제목,소개등 여러가지 속성들(=메타데이터 )을 담는 태그 :실제 웹사이트 컨텐츠 multi page application: 여러 html존재, 사용자요청에 따라 새로운 페이지 로딩 single page application (SPA) 단 하나의 page(html파일) 존재 body태그의 내용은 빈 상태로 시작 특정 페이지 접속시 해당 컨텐츠의 정보를 가져와서 동적으로 body태그 내부를 채움 className ) 3.반드시 하나의 요소로 감쌀 것..
2022.07.24 -
아나콘다 환경설정
Anaconda Prompt 실행 conda env list //설치환경 확인 conda update -n base -c defaults conda //기본채널 base환경에서 conda 명령을 업데이트 conda create -n study36 python=3.6 // conda명령을 이용해 이름(-n)이 study36인 환경을 python3.6으로 생성 conda env list //study36 설치확인 conda activate study36 // (base) >> (study36)으로 변경확인 pip list //현재 설치된 파이선 모듈확인 python -m pip install -U pip //-m은 모듈실행명령, pip명령을 파이선에서 스크립트처럼 실행하라는 의미 pip install jup..
2022.06.07 -
미니프로젝트 2.0 2022.05.22